David Lyons

David's racing career began at the stables of Martin Pipe as a pupil assistant trainer in 1984, from where he moved on to be a jockeys' agent for six jockeys between 1987-92, handling, amongst others, Richard Guest and Billy Newnes in the process. In 1985 David landed his first journalist position with the Racing & Football Outlook and over the course of the next 17 years David wrote for; The Sporting Life and SL Weekender, The Racing Post and The Western Morning News. The benefit of this grounding in the game was clearly seen with David's tipping service www.dailydabble.com, which made a year on year profit for four of its five years of trading between 2001-2006.
